Fn 509 9mm 4″ 10+1 Polymer 66100588

$656.10

Fn 509 9mm 4″ 10+1 Polymer 66100588

$656.10

Estimated Delivery Date November 26, 2024 - November 28, 2024
SKU: 66100588 Category: Tags: , ,